import torch.nn.functional as F | |
def sigmoid_focal_loss(inputs, targets, num_boxes, alpha: float = 0.25, gamma: float = 2): | |
""" | |
Loss used in RetinaNet for dense detection: https://arxiv.org/abs/1708.02002. | |
Args: | |
inputs (torch.Tensor): A float tensor of arbitrary shape. | |
The predictions for each example. | |
targets (torch.Tensor): A float tensor with the same shape as inputs. Stores the binary | |
classification label for each element in inputs | |
(0 for the negative class and 1 for the positive class). | |
num_boxes (int): The number of boxes. | |
alpha (float, optional): Weighting factor in range (0, 1) to balance | |
positive vs negative examples. Default: 0.25. | |
gamma (float): Exponent of the modulating factor (1 - p_t) to | |
balance easy vs hard examples. Default: 2. | |
Returns: | |
torch.Tensor: The computed sigmoid focal loss. | |
""" | |
inputs = inputs.float() | |
targets = targets.float() | |
prob = inputs.sigmoid() | |
ce_loss = F.binary_cross_entropy_with_logits(inputs, targets, reduction="none") | |
p_t = prob * targets + (1 - prob) * (1 - targets) | |
loss = ce_loss * ((1 - p_t) ** gamma) | |
if alpha >= 0: | |
alpha_t = alpha * targets + (1 - alpha) * (1 - targets) | |
loss = alpha_t * loss | |
return loss.mean(1).sum() / num_boxes | |
def dice_loss(inputs, targets, num_boxes): | |
""" | |
Compute the DICE loss, similar to generalized IOU for masks | |
Args: | |
inputs (torch.Tensor): A float tensor of arbitrary shape. | |
The predictions for each example. | |
targets (torch.Tensor): | |
A float tensor with the same shape as inputs. Stores the binary | |
classification label for each element in inputs | |
(0 for the negative class and 1 for the positive class). | |
num_boxes (int): The number of boxes. | |
Return: | |
torch.Tensor: The computed dice loss. | |
""" | |
inputs = inputs.sigmoid() | |
inputs = inputs.flatten(1) | |
numerator = 2 * (inputs * targets).sum(1) | |
denominator = inputs.sum(-1) + targets.sum(-1) | |
loss = 1 - (numerator + 1) / (denominator + 1) | |
return loss.sum() / num_boxes | |
